Output 85e66c603c833d26876cc46e1aabb26c024c1329e3b2d9c88bfc70e37b264e74:39

value
895070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b89bb3f447b04be7f94106afcc25a59d8f82bbb4 OP_EQUAL
address
3JX8nGfbZRQKjWdk5Kt7XDurDAseKe6bMT
transaction
85e66c603c833d26876cc46e1aabb26c024c1329e3b2d9c88bfc70e37b264e74
spent
true